Job description

Mace combines construction expertise with consultancy to unlock potential in every person or project and redefine the boundaries of ambition. Our values shape the way we consult and define the people we want to join us on our journey.

Mace is seeking an experienced Automation Engineer to support the delivery of a major sterile manufacturing and facility expansion programme within a highly regulated GMP environment. The role will provide technical leadership and oversight for automation systems associated with process equipment, cleanroom facilities and critical utilities. Working as part of an integrated project team, you will support the development, implementation, testing and qualification of automation solutions while ensuring compliance with quality, regulatory and digital standards.

You’ll Be Responsible For
  • Developing and implementing automation strategies aligned with project and client digital standards.
  • Producing and review user requirement specifications (URS), functional design specifications (FDS) and system design specifications (SDS).
  • Providing technical oversight of PLC, SCADA, DCS and building management system (BMS) solutions.
  • Managing integration of automation systems with site infrastructure, manufacturing execution systems (MES), historians and other digital platforms.
  • Supporting data integrity, computer system validation (CSV) and cybersecurity requirements for regulated systems.
  • Reviewing vendor and contractor automation designs, specifications and technical submissions.
  • Participating in design reviews, risk assessments, FMEA workshops and qualification activities.
  • Supporting factory acceptance testing (FAT), site acceptance testing (SAT), commissioning and qualification activities.
  • Assisting with automation testing, alarm management and system verification activities.
  • Ensuring robust documentation, traceability and handover processes are maintained throughout the project lifecycle.
  • The successful candidate may be required to support a range of systems, including:
    • Processing equipment automation.
    • Cleanroom and environmental control systems.
    • Autoclaves and sterilisation equipment.
    • Washers and decontamination systems.
    • HVAC and critical ventilation systems.
    • Utility control systems.
    • Building Management Systems (BMS)
    • PLC, SCADA and DCS platforms.
You’ll Need To Have
  • Degree qualified in Automation, Control Systems, Electrical Engineering or a related discipline.
  • Proven experience delivering automation solutions within pharmaceutical, biotechnology, life sciences, healthcare or other highly regulated environments.
  • Strong knowledge of PLC, SCADA, DCS and industrial control systems.
  • Experience supporting commissioning, qualification and validation activities.
  • Understanding of GMP principles, data integrity and computer system validation requirements.
  • Experience reviewing design documentation and managing technical interfaces with vendors and contractors.
  • Excellent stakeholder management and communication skills.
  • Experience working within sterile manufacturing or aseptic processing facilities.
  • Knowledge of EU GMP, Annex 1, MHRA or FDA regulatory requirements.
  • Experience with MES integration and manufacturing digitalisation programmes.
  • Familiarity with cybersecurity requirements for operational technology (OT) environments.
  • Chartered Engineer status or progress towards professional accreditation.
